When waiting for the request to be granted when calling lockComplete, the predicate could initially return true when we call waitForConditionOrInterrupt. This would mean that we never check if the operation context was killed, and so the operation continues even if it had been killed. This can happen if the lock request was granted very quickly after lockComplete is called.
